Spring Hill and Williams Creek are places in Indiana.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Williams Creek has the higher population (453 vs 68 in Spring Hill). Williams Creek has the higher median household income ($218,750 vs $134,375 in Spring Hill). Williams Creek has the higher median home value ($1,212,100 vs $327,300 in Spring Hill).
